Say It Ain't So by Weezer

From the album, Weezer, released on May 10, 1994

"Say It Ain't So" is a song by American rock band Weezer. The song was released as the second single from their self-titled debut album, also known as the Blue Album, on January 10, 1995. The song was written by frontman Rivers Cuomo and produced by Cars frontman Ric Ocasek. The song's lyrics are about Cuomo's discovery that his father had been cheating on his mother and the anguish he felt as a result. The song was a moderate success, peaking at number 16 on the US Billboard Modern Rock Tracks chart and number 24 on the UK Singles Chart. The song's music video, directed by Kevin Kerslake, was nominated for Best Alternative Video at the 1995 MTV Video Music Awards.

I Need A Dollar by Aloe Blacc

From the album, Good Things, released on September 28, 2010

"I Need a Dollar" is a song by American singer-songwriter Aloe Blacc. It was released as the lead single from his debut studio album, Good Things (2010). The song was produced by Truth & Soul and written by Blacc, Nick Movshon, Jeff Dynamite, and Leon Michels. The song is a mid-tempo soul number with a backing track composed of horns, organs, and electric guitar. It features Blacc singing about his poverty-stricken life and his need for money. The song was a critical and commercial success, reaching number two on the UK Singles Chart and number one on the US Billboard Hot R&B/Hip-Hop Songs chart.
